Women entrepreneurs today are successfully making names for themselves, significantly reshaping the landscape of modern business. But every now and then, a story emerges that doesn’t just inspire — it redefines what building an empire can actually look like. Dr. Zarine Manchanda is one such story.

As CEO of Zarine Manchanda Enterprises, she oversees five distinct businesses — the Zarine Manchanda Café, Heavenly Flavors Cloud Kitchen, a restaurant celebrating the authentic flavors of Himachal Pradesh, Zarine Manchanda Security Agency, and Zarine Manchanda Productions. Each venture is different. Each carries the same unmistakable signature.

A Crucial Turning Point

Zarine’s journey took a pivotal turn when she learned the importance of having a backup plan — a lesson quietly passed down by her mother.

Her first dream was to act. The stage, the craft, the camera — that was the plan. But circumstances led her elsewhere. Inspired by her father’s legacy as a respected politician and minister, she turned toward a different kind of purpose. In 2019, she launched the Zarine Manchanda Foundation — not after the money came in, not after the businesses were built. First. Before any of it.

The Foundation began in Aarey Colony and later expanded into Andheri. Over four years, more than 500 charitable initiatives for Mumbai’s most invisible residents. She describes the work as her life’s mission. Says it fills her with empathy and energy in a way the boardroom doesn’t quite replicate.

Prestigious Roles and Enduring Impact

Zarine’s journey includes appointments that speak to an influence running well beyond Mumbai’s business circles.

As Regional Director of BRICS, she plays a central role in shaping India’s international trade relationships — a position that demands diplomatic precision and long-term strategic thinking. Her role as Chairperson and Editor-in-Chief for Maharashtra, Goa, and Himachal Pradesh at the National Council of News and Broadcasting reflects her commitment to media reform, press freedom, and human rights.
